文档

相交类算子

更新时间:

判断左侧对象和右侧对象的外包框是否在指定维度上相交。

语法

{geometry, trajectory, boxndf} /&/ {geometry, trajectory, boxndf}
{trajectory, boxndf} #&# {trajectory, boxndf}
{geometry, trajectory, boxndf} && {geometry, trajectory, boxndf}
{geometry, trajectory, boxndf} &/& {geometry, trajectory, boxndf}
{trajectory, boxndf} &#& {trajectory, boxndf}
{trajectory, boxndf} &/#& {trajectory, boxndf}

参数

参数名称

描述

算子左侧参数

相交对象。

算子右侧参数

相交对象。

描述

判断左侧对象和右侧对象的外包框(由ST_MakeBox函数生成的BoxNDF类型)是否在指定维度上相交。

支持的相交类算子如下:

  • /&/:z维度相交。

  • #&#:t维度相交。

  • &&:xy二维空间相交。

  • &/&:xyz三维空间相交。

  • &#&:xyt二维时空相交。

  • &/#&:xyzt三维时空相交。

示例

WITH box AS(
    SELECT ST_MakeBox3d(0,0,0,5,5,5) a,
           ST_MakeBox3dt(6,6,3,'2010-04-12 00:00:00',8,8,5,'2013-02-01 00:00:00') b
)
SELECT a /&/ b AS OpZ, a #&# b AS OpT, a && b AS Op2D, a &/& b AS Op3d, a &#& b AS Op2DT, a &/#& b AS Op3DT from box;
 opz | opt | op2d | op3d | op2dt | op3dt 
-----+-----+------+------+-------+-------
 t   | t   | f    | f    | f     | f
            
  • 本页导读 (1)
文档反馈